2026 Training Program for Emerging Leaders EDA Atlanta Region Application

With support from the U.S. Economic Development Administration, Atlanta Regional Office, the NADO Research Foundation is pleased to announce the application process for the inaugural cohort of the Training Program for Emerging Leaders (Emerging Leaders).

The Emerging Leaders program provides EDD staff members with the education and skills required to lead a high-performing EDD. Cohort participants are offered a unique opportunity to learn about successful community and economic development approaches of other EDDs in the southeast region and beyond through on-site trainings. Additionally, the program is an opportunity to create a peer network across the Atlanta Regional Office service area that can add value to EDD activities long after the training program is finished.

Interested staff of EDDs are invited to apply for the 2026 Cohort of the Emerging Leaders. Applications are due Friday, June 5, 2026, and the training will be completed between July and December 2026.

The sites visits and conferences are as follows (plus a possible day before or after to accommodate travel):

  • July 19-25, 2026 | EDA Atlanta Regional Conference | East Alabama & Northwest Georgia Site Visits
  • September 21-24, 2026 | North Carolina Site Visits
  • October 26-30, 2026 | NADO Annual Training Conference, Reno, NV | Western Nevada Development District Site Visit
  • December 7-10, 2026 | Western Kentucky Site Visits
